  1. Promotes Hair Growth

Rosemary essential oil is widely used to promote hair growth and prevent hair loss. It stimulates blood circulation in the scalp, which can help improve hair growth. It also contains antioxidants that help fight free radicals and prevent damage to the hair follicles. To use rosemary oil for hair growth, mix a few drops with a carrier oil like coconut or jojoba oil, and massage it into your scalp for a few minutes before washing your hair.

  1. Reduces Dandruff

Dandruff is a common scalp condition that can be both embarrassing and uncomfortable. Rosemary essential oil is a natural remedy that can help reduce dandruff and soothe an itchy scalp. It has anti-inflammatory and anti-fungal properties that can help reduce inflammation and prevent the growth of dandruff-causing bacteria. Mix a few drops of rosemary oil with a carrier oil like olive or coconut oil, and massage it into your scalp to help reduce dandruff.

  1. Improves Skin Health

Rosemary essential oil has numerous benefits for the skin. It contains antioxidants that can help protect the skin from damage caused by free radicals. It also has anti-inflammatory properties that can help reduce inflammation and redness in the skin. Rosemary oil is also known to stimulate cell renewal, which can help improve the overall appearance of the skin. To use rosemary oil for skin health, mix a few drops with a carrier oil like almond or jojoba oil, and massage it into your skin.

  1. Fights Acne

Acne is a common skin condition that can be difficult to treat. Rosemary essential oil is a natural remedy that can help fight acne and prevent breakouts. It has anti-inflammatory and antimicrobial properties that can help reduce inflammation and kill the bacteria that cause acne. To use rosemary oil for acne, mix a few drops with a carrier oil like grapeseed or jojoba oil, and apply it to the affected areas.
